Transaction 7503f955731d5795493c548c404b505797c14e6147c9e11b4de5ab4ec7274a02

1 Input
2 Outputs
  • 7503f955731d5795493c548c404b505797c14e6147c9e11b4de5ab4ec7274a02:0
  • value  1129468549
    address  39BgSRvwBHpL9DFmUspijKkqET6A1nhHFp
  • 7503f955731d5795493c548c404b505797c14e6147c9e11b4de5ab4ec7274a02:1
  • value  22853322
    address  15W9uKa4HuuYdQ4uV7uAiMfnu4uQwfhRHv